Abstract

The EU funded Global-Bio-Pact project developed a set of socio-economic impact indicators. The purpose was not to create a new standard or scheme for bioenergy production, but to compile a set of socio-economic sustainability criteria and indicators for biomass production and conversion which could be used by developers, governments, nongovernmental organizations or as an aid to existing standards. The set of indicators was tested in two locations in South America, which comprise the two case studies reported in the chapter. The selected indicators are introduced and discussed here, along with an assessment of the results from their application in the field.
